The Protect the Right to Organize Act is the focus of this week’s 141 Report. The Northern Virginia President of the AFL-CIO, Virginia Diamond, fills the viewers and listeners in on why this federal legislation is vital to American workers. Sister Diamond describes the action that union workers are taking to get Virginia’s Senators to sign on to support passing the Pro-ACT.
